Possible Causes of Carpet Water Damage

There are several common reasons why carpets sustain water damage. One of the primary causes is burst or leaking pipes, which can lead to significant flooding inside your home. Sudden appliance failures, such as washing machines or dishwashers, can also release large volumes of water, soaking carpets quickly. Additionally, severe weather events like heavy rains or roof leaks can allow water to seep into your home and puddle on the floor, saturating your carpets.

Another common cause involves plumbing or sewer backups, which can introduce contaminated water into your carpets, making cleanup more urgent and comprehensive. Older carpets and inadequate waterproofing can increase vulnerability to water damage, especially during storms or plumbing issues. Regardless of the cause, swift intervention is essential to prevent further damage, mold growth, and health risks.

How Can We Fix That

Our team begins with a thorough assessment to evaluate the extent of water penetration into your carpets and underlying flooring. We use advanced moisture detection tools to identify hidden pockets of moisture, ensuring no area is overlooked. Once the assessment is complete, we employ professional equipment, such as industrial-grade extractors and dehumidifiers, to remove standing water and dry the affected areas thoroughly.

We then focus on cleaning and disinfecting your carpets to eliminate bacteria, mold spores, and foul odors caused by water exposure. For carpets that are severely damaged, we offer options such as deep cleaning, sanitation, or carpet removal and replacement if necessary. Our experts also repair or replace the padding and underlying subflooring to prevent future issues. We work diligently to restore your carpets to a condition that feels fresh, clean, and safe for your family.

Throughout the process, our team ensures that your home remains safe and sanitary. We monitor moisture levels continuously to guarantee complete dryness before completing the restoration. Our goal is to provide a comprehensive solution that addresses both the visible damage and hidden moisture, preventing mold growth or structural deterioration down the line.

Frequently Asked Questions

How quickly should I act after discovering water damage?

Will my carpet be salvable after water damage?

In many cases, we can restore waterlogged carpets through professional cleaning and drying. However, severely damaged or mold-infested carpets may need replacement. Our team will assess and advise accordingly.

How long does a typical carpet water damage restoration take?

The timeline depends on the extent of the damage. Minor incidents may take a few hours, while extensive flooding can require several days. We prioritize efficient service to restore your home quickly.

Can I attempt to dry my carpets myself?

While quick DIY actions can help, professional equipment ensures complete drying and sanitation. Our experts can do this more effectively and thoroughly to prevent mold and odors.
